French Goalkeeper Highlights Five Attacking Qualities Of The 'New Drogba', Victor Osimhen
Published: April 06, 2020
Veteran Sporting Charleroi goalkeeper Nicolas Penneteau is not surprised by the progress of Victor Osimhen this season and has tipped the Nigeria international to be the next Didier Drogba of the French Ligue 1.
Osimhen is one of the most coveted young players in France, perhaps only behind PSG's Kylian Mbappe, following his brilliant form that has seen him find the net eighteen times in 38 matches in all competitions this season.
Speaking to RMC Sport, Penneteau said : "He doesn't surprise me. When we discovered him, when he arrived, two clubs refused to take him for small physical problems.
"From the first training sessions we saw that he was a player of another class . I said it when he arrived in Lille but for me he may be the future Drogba of the French championship."
Penneteau went on to reveal that Osimhen is a complete striker and highlighted five qualities of the Super Eagles rising star.
"If there are at least two seasons left , he will score goal by goal.
"He has all the qualities of a modern striker. He is fast, he jumps high, strong in duels , good with the ball, he plays in depth. He will erase his little imperfections while playing, he is a phenomenon," added the 39-year-old goalkeeper.

A former France U18 international, Penneteau was in goal for Corsica as they held the Super Eagles to a 1-1 draw in an international friendly in May 2017.
